
在Excel中,设置日期为固定值的方法有多种,如使用公式、手动输入、利用快捷键等。 其中最直接的方法就是手动输入日期,利用快捷键也很方便。下面我会详细介绍其中一种方法:使用Excel的快捷键将当前日期固定下来,即使数据刷新或其他单元格内容改变,日期也不会变动。
一、使用快捷键设置固定日期
使用快捷键设置固定日期是最简单且高效的方法之一。这种方法适用于需要快速记录当前日期的场景。
1、快捷键介绍
在Excel中,可以通过按下 Ctrl + ; 快捷键来插入当前日期。这种方法可以确保插入的日期是固定的,不会随着工作表的刷新而改变。
2、操作步骤
- 打开Excel工作簿并选择你希望插入固定日期的单元格。
- 按下键盘上的
Ctrl+;组合键。 - 当前日期将会自动填入所选的单元格中。
这样插入的日期是静态的,即使你关闭并重新打开文件,日期也不会改变。
二、手动输入固定日期
手动输入日期也是一种常见的方法,适用于你需要输入指定日期的情况。
1、操作步骤
- 打开Excel工作簿并选择你希望插入固定日期的单元格。
- 直接输入你需要的日期,例如
2023-10-01或10/01/2023,然后按Enter键。
这种方法同样会生成一个静态日期,且不会因为文件的刷新或其他操作而发生变化。
三、使用公式设置固定日期
有时候,可能需要通过公式来生成一个固定的日期值。虽然Excel中的大多数日期函数(如 TODAY() 和 NOW())都会随时间更新,但我们可以通过特定的操作来固定这些值。
1、使用公式生成日期
- 在单元格中输入公式
=TODAY()或=NOW()来生成当前日期或时间。 - 选中生成日期的单元格,然后按下
Ctrl+C复制该单元格。 - 右键点击目标单元格,选择
选择性粘贴或Paste Special。 - 在弹出的对话框中选择
数值或Values,然后点击确定。
通过这种方法,公式生成的动态日期将被转换成静态值。
四、使用数据验证功能
Excel的数据验证功能可以用来确保输入的日期符合特定格式,并防止用户输入无效日期。
1、设置数据验证
- 选中你希望应用日期验证的单元格范围。
- 点击菜单栏中的
数据,然后选择数据验证。 - 在弹出的对话框中选择
日期作为允许类型,设置起始和结束日期范围。
这种方法可以帮助你确保输入的日期始终在预期的范围内,并防止输入错误。
五、利用VBA宏固定日期
对于高级用户,可以编写简单的VBA宏来自动插入和固定日期。VBA宏可以根据特定条件插入日期,从而提高工作效率。
1、编写VBA宏
- 按
Alt+F11打开VBA编辑器。 - 插入一个新的模块,并输入以下代码:
Sub InsertFixedDate()
Dim rng As Range
Set rng = Selection
rng.Value = Date
End Sub
- 保存并关闭VBA编辑器。
通过运行这个宏,你可以在选中的单元格中插入当前日期,并且该日期是固定的。
六、使用自定义格式显示日期
Excel允许用户通过自定义格式来显示日期,从而满足不同的需求。
1、设置自定义格式
- 选中你希望应用自定义日期格式的单元格。
- 右键点击单元格,选择
设置单元格格式。 - 在弹出的对话框中选择
数字标签,点击自定义。 - 输入你希望的日期格式,例如
yyyy-mm-dd或dd/mm/yyyy,然后点击确定。
这种方法可以帮助你在输入固定日期的同时,以特定格式显示日期。
七、保护工作表防止修改日期
为了确保日期固定不变,可以通过保护工作表来防止其他用户修改日期。
1、保护工作表
- 选中你希望保护的单元格范围。
- 右键点击单元格,选择
设置单元格格式。 - 在弹出的对话框中选择
保护标签,确保锁定选项被勾选。 - 返回Excel主界面,点击菜单栏中的
审阅,选择保护工作表。 - 设置密码并确认。
通过这种方法,其他用户无法修改受保护的单元格,从而确保日期固定。
八、总结
在Excel中设置固定日期的方法有很多,包括使用快捷键、手动输入、公式转换、数据验证、VBA宏、自定义格式和保护工作表等。每种方法都有其独特的优势,用户可以根据具体需求选择合适的方法来确保日期固定不变。无论选择哪种方法,都可以有效提高工作效率,确保数据的准确性和一致性。
相关问答FAQs:
1. 如何在Excel中将日期设置为固定格式?
在Excel中,将日期设置为固定格式非常简单。请按照以下步骤进行操作:
- 选中包含日期的单元格或日期范围。
- 单击右键,选择“格式单元格”选项。
- 在弹出的对话框中,选择“数字”选项卡。
- 在“类别”列表中,选择“日期”。
- 在“类型”列表中,选择所需的日期格式,如“年-月-日”或“月/日/年”等。
- 单击“确定”按钮应用更改。
2. 如何在Excel中固定日期以便随着单元格拖动而保持不变?
如果您想在Excel中固定日期以便随着单元格的拖动而保持不变,可以使用以下方法:
- 在公式中使用$符号来锁定日期的列和行。例如,如果日期在A列,公式为=$A$1,这样无论单元格如何拖动,日期都会保持不变。
3. 我怎样在Excel中设置一个固定的日期,以便在其他工作表中引用?
在Excel中,您可以通过以下步骤设置一个固定的日期以便在其他工作表中引用:
- 在源工作表中选中日期单元格。
- 在公式栏中复制日期单元格的引用。
- 切换到目标工作表。
- 在目标工作表的目标单元格中粘贴引用。
- 确保粘贴的引用包含$符号来锁定日期的列和行,以便在其他工作表中引用时日期保持不变。例如,如果日期在A列,公式为='源工作表'!$A$1。
通过这种方式,您可以在其他工作表中引用固定的日期,并确保日期在引用时保持不变。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4909146